Internal Phone Numbers
Internal numbers must be configured for the internal ports so that the
connected end devices are accessible. Each connected end device
receives a subscriber number.
If multiple internal end devices need to be accessible via a phone number,
a common group for the internal subscribers must first be configured.
Internal phone are also needed to make e. g. connections to devices, voip
accounts or functions.
Note: It is a good idea to create a phone numbering plan for the internal
numbers before allocation and then use the following steps to transmit
this to the PBX.
Proceed as follows for configuration:
•
Create internal phone numbers for subscribers.
– Using the Configuration Manager (page Abonnés (Abo) > Numéros
de téléphone)
•
Create internal phone numbers for groups.
– Using the Configuration Manager (page Groupes > Numéros de
téléphone)
•
Create internal phone numbers for Voice mail/fax boxes.
– Using the Configuration Manager (page Périphériques > Boîtes de
messagerie vocale/télécopie > Numéros de téléphone)
•
Create internal numbers for door stations and announcement outputs.
– Using the Configuration Manager (page Périphériques > Assistant
de périphériques)
